Keep your head up, take it a month at a time, focus on your milestones. Also early work pays off. Doing toe-yoga and working out early on seems boring and you just want to get back to heel raises and such, but it all stacks up. Pays to build a good foundation.

I’m 10 months post op, running and working out like normal. Playing basketball again. You’ll get back there if you want.

Nice! Tip from my PT that helped me a lot; do your exercises without shoes. Depending on your shoes they may provide too much cushion and limit the range you’re pushing through.

Recurring rust help! by Electrical-Volume765 in woodworking

[–]Playoff_p 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Wax will wear off - especially if you use in between applications. Use a cover, consider Carbon Method coat, and remove the source of humidity/moisture.
